Drucktransmittern
Drucktransmittern, also known as pressure transmitters, are devices used to measure pressure and convert it into an electrical signal. This signal can then be transmitted to a control system or monitoring device for further processing. They are essential components in many industrial and scientific applications where pressure monitoring is critical.
The fundamental principle behind most drucktransmittern involves a sensing element that deforms when subjected to pressure.
